145252-54-6,145610-25-9,132773-08-1,129421-33-6,132775-74-7,132776-17-1 Supplier | CHEMEXPLORE.CN
CMO CDMO service. CHEMEXPLORE.CN supply 145252-54-6,145610-25-9,132773-08-1,129421-33-6,132775-74-7,132776-17-1 and related compounds.
145610-25-9 132773-08-1 132776-17-1 132775-74-7 129421-33-6 145252-54-6